Taoiseach backs John O'Donoghue in FAI row
19:23 Friday November 12th 2004
The Taoiseach has commented on the row of the appointment of the FAI Chief Executive
Irish soccer's governing body wants to appoint its Honorary Secretary John Delaney to the post for an interim period, but this may lead to the Government pulling FAI funding.
The Minister for Sport John O'Donoghue wants the positions of Chief Executive and Director of Finance advertised before the New Year.
The Taoiseach Bertie Ahern has backed this stance, "They are going through secretary generals quicker that Italy went through premiers after the war, and that's not a good idea."
